Accept ClosePress Tab to Move to Skip to Content LinkSearch JobsJob DescriptionJob Title: Research Assistant (Dept of Pathology)Posting Start Date: 11/03/2025Job Description:Job DescriptionThe Research Assistant will be in charge of projects in the lab or assisting PI/postdoc with the projects, so prior research experience is necessary. In particular experience in the areas of molecular and cell biology will be favored. The projects will involve studies of drug interactions, cancer metabolism, synthetic lethality and tumor suppressors in cancer cells.
  • Should have strong background in cellular biology and molecular biology
  • Should have vast experience with cell and tissue culture, and familiar with various cell based assays
  • Some experience in mouse maintenance will be favorable.
  • Will be in charge of lab inventory and purchasing
  • Will be involved with the general administration and maintenance of the lab
QualificationsWe are looking for highly motivated individuals able to work well in a team. Applicants should have a strong interest in experimental research, particularly in molecular and cellular biology. Excellent communication skills required.Applicants should hold a degree in molecular & cellular biology or life sciences and preferably have prior experience in research.
